Gap States in Dilute Magnetic Alloy Superconductors

arXiv:cond-mat/9607012 · doi:10.1103/PhysRevLett.77.3621

Abstract

We study states in the superconducting gap induced by magnetic impurities using self-consistent quantum Monte Carlo with maximum entropy and formally exact analytic continuation methods. The magnetic impurity susceptibility has different characteristics for $T_{0} \alt T_{c0}$ and $T_{0} \agt T_{c0}$ (: Kondo temperature, : superconducting transition temperature) due to the crossover between a doublet and a singlet ground state. We systematically study the location and the weight of the gap states and the gap parameter as a function of and the concentration of the impurities.
